Madhouse Mon Cheri  
Off the hip cackle  
“This is where rich folks go crazy”  
Staff shocked  
By her brassy voodoo spell  
 
First trembling bird peck  
On Creole lips designed  
For madhouse paradise  
A touch of Hatter’s petal blues  
Hinted in her hazel eyes  
Torn from the Virgin ligaments  
Of an Achille’s dream  
In my fragmented mind  
 
A late Bar Mitzvah  
She succored me  
In penciled lip balm  
That sketched my heart  
In pastel remedies for solitude

Author's Note
She and I were sitting across from each other at a table. I think she asked me if I loved her. I said, "Always my love." And we spontaneously stood up and kissed each other. The staff discouraged physical contact between patients but let this one go.
